The US, together with its allies, liberated the 100 percent of the territories of Syria and Iraq from the "Islamic State", US President Donald Trump noted, Reuters reported.

He added that from time to time these villains will show themselves, but they have lost all prestige and power, and the United States will “remain vigilant and fight until the IS is finally defeated.”

On March 22, a representative of the White House recalled that the IS no longer controls the territory in Syria. In early February, Trump gave his generals the "green light" for the final destruction of militants in Iraq.

According to the UN, the IS still has financial reserves in the amount of 50 to 300 million dollars and ovet 14 to 18 thousand militants, of which three thousand are foreigners.
